💬 As we mark #WorldAIDSDay, let's commit to #PutPeopleFirst in our language:

✅ "People living with HIV"
❌ "Infected people"

✅ "Acquired HIV"
❌ "Caught HIV"

✅ "HIV acquisition"
❌ "Infection"

In our previous policy brief, we highlighted three key actions to tackle the #HIV and mental health crises in the 🇵🇭: 1) Engage communities in the HIV response; 2) Equitably increase funding and resources; 3) Enhance a multi-sectoral HIV response.

The #Philippines is facing one of the highest increases in people living with #HIV. Despite this public health emergency, efforts tackling HIV could be at risk due to uncertainty in global HIV funding, especially following the US's halt of #PEPFAR.
